Ukuze usebenzise i-RV air conditioner kwiibhetri, kuya kufuneka uqikelele ngokusekwe koku kulandelayo:
- IiMfuno zaMandla zeYunithi ye-AC: I-RV air conditioners idla ngokufuna phakathi kwe-1,500 ukuya kwi-2,000 watts ukuze isebenze, ngamanye amaxesha ngaphezulu ngokuxhomekeke kubukhulu beyunithi. Makhe sicinge iyunithi ye-AC engama-2,000-watt njengomzekelo.
- I-Voltage yeBattery kunye neCapacity: Uninzi lwee-RV zisebenzisa i-12V okanye i-24V iibhanki zebhetri, kwaye ezinye zingasebenzisa i-48V ngokufanelekileyo. Amandla ebhetri aqhelekileyo alinganiswa ngee-amp-yure (Ah).
- Ukuphumelela kwe-Inverter: Ekubeni i-AC isebenza kwi-AC (alternating current) amandla, uya kufuna i-inverter ukuguqula amandla e-DC (angoku ngqo) ukusuka kwiibhetri. Ii-inverters zihlala ziyi-85-90% esebenzayo, oku kuthetha ukuba amandla athile alahlekile ngexesha lokuguqulwa.
- Imfuneko yexesha lokubaleka: Qinisekisa ukuba uceba ukuyisebenzisa ixesha elingakanani i-AC. Umzekelo, ukuyiqhuba iiyure ezi-2 xa kuthelekiswa neeyure ezisi-8 kuchaphazela kakhulu amandla ewonke afunekayo.
Umzekelo wokubala
Cinga ukuba ufuna ukuqhuba iyunithi ye-2,000W ye-AC iiyure ze-5, kwaye usebenzisa i-12V 100Ah LiFePO4 iibhetri.
- Bala zizonke iiWatt-iiyure ezifunekayo:
- 2,000 watts × 5 iiyure = 10,000 watt-iiyure (Wh)
- Iakhawunti ye-Inverter Efficiency(thatha i-90% esebenzayo):
- 10,000 Wh / 0.9 = 11,111 Wh (isondezwe ilahleko)
- Guqula iiWatt-Hours zibe zii-Amp-Hours (kwibhetri ye-12V):
- 11,111 Wh / 12V = 926 Ah
- Qinisekisa inani leebhetri:
- Ngeebhetri ze-12V 100Ah, uya kufuna i-926 Ah / 100 Ah = ~ 9.3 iibhetri.
Kuba iibhetri zingezi ngamaqhezu, uyakufuna10 x 12V 100Ah iibhetriukuqhuba iyunithi ye-2,000W RV AC malunga neeyure ezi-5.
Olunye Ukhetho Lolungelelwaniso olwahlukileyo
Ukuba usebenzisa inkqubo ye-24V, unokunciphisa iimfuno zeyure ye-amp, okanye nge-48V inkqubo, yikota. Kungenjalo, ukusebenzisa iibhetri ezinkulu (umz., 200Ah) kunciphisa inani leeyunithi ezifunekayo.
